#0912f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0912fe is composed of 3.5% red, 7.1%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.5% cyan, 92.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 237.8 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 51.6%. #0912fe color hex could be obtained by blending #1224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

#0912f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0912fe has RGB values of R:9, G:18,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 594686.

Shades and Tints of #0912f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000008 is the darkest color, while #f3f4ff is the lightest one.
